Theo'dotus
2. A Phoenician historian, who lived before Josephus, and wrote a history of his native country, in the Phoenician tongue, which was translated into Greek by a certain Laetus, if we adopt the correction of Reinesius in the passage of Tatian, where the MSS. give
Χαῖτος or
Ἄσιτος (Tatian.
ad v. Graec. 58. p. 128, ed. Worth; Joseph.
c. Apion. 1.23;
Euseb. Praep. Ev. 10.11; Vossius,
de Hist. Graec. p. 504.)
